The Delta emulator is compatible with the latest iPhone models including the iPhone 13 and also it is compatible with the latest iOS 16 versions. Source: almost 2 years ago
When you install the Delta Emulator on your iOS device, you can open it without creating any user accounts and also you do not need to enter your Apple ID. If you open the Delta emulator for the first time, you will not see available games on your home screen. So that you need to add games to the Delta Emulator.
